Obituary

Dorothy Myers Watkins, 75, passed away peacefully on August 29th, 2026 surrounded by her loving family.

Dotty was born in Augusta, Georgia, on September 24, 1950. She spent most of her life in Evans, Georgia. Dotty devoted her life to caring for her family. She worked in Lab management at Medical College of Georgia in the early 1970s, and later as a convenience store clerk, where she had many “regulars” who knew her well. Her most important jobs though were Momma, Nana, sister, Aunt and friend. She was known for her determination, quick wit, and the way she made everyone feel welcome at her kitchen table.

Dotty loved reading, cooking and feeding people and cheering on her children, grandchildren, nieces, nephews and friends. Her greatest joy was spending time with those she loved.

She is survived by two daughters, Cheralyn Wheeler (Kenny) and Leslie (Michael) Cartledge of Evans; two grandchildren, Justin (Yami) Wheeler (Ludowici, GA) and Linzie Wheeler (Philadelphia, PA); one great grandchild, Jonah Wheeler; and her sister, Sally Aenchbacher as well as countless nieces and nephews, cousins and friends. She was preceded in death by her daughter, Meagan and Husband, Chuck Watkins.

The family will receive visitors on Thursday, September 3rd from 5:00 to 7:00 PM at King Funeral Home on Davis Road in Martinez, GA and a graveside service will be held at 11:00 AM on Friday, September 4th, 2026, at Bellevue Memorial Gardens in Grovetown, GA.

In lieu of flowers the family kindly requests donations be made to the Georgia Cancer Center. 

Her legacy of love, compassion, and strength will live on in the hearts of all who knew her.
